
While Working Mother 100 Best Companies is by far our oldest list (25 years in 2010!), it’s not our only one. Each year, our research team gathers data from thousands of questions and hundreds of companies to track key work-life and diversity trends impacting working women (and their families) today.
In 2010: our newest project: Best Companies for Hourly Workers, spotlighting the best programs and policies serving non-salaried workers today. Created in partnership with Corporate Voices for Working Families, a Washington, DC-based non-profit organization dedicated to improving the lives of working families, this initiative will look at everything from hiring and advancement to flexibility and training. Winners of Best Companies for Hourly Workers to be announced in the May 2010 issue of Working Mother, on workingmother.com and at a new Best Companies for Hourly Workers event to be held May 4th in Washington, D.C.
